在js分享中,如何确保使用安全域名避免潜在风险?

在互联网时代,JavaScript(JS)作为一种强大的前端脚本语言,被广泛应用于网站和应用程序的开发中,随着JS功能的增强,安全问题也日益凸显,本文将探讨JS分享安全域名的重要性,并提供一些实用的安全策略。

在js分享中,如何确保使用安全域名避免潜在风险?

JS分享安全域名的重要性

防止XSS攻击

跨站脚本攻击(XSS)是一种常见的网络安全威胁,攻击者通过在网页中注入恶意脚本,窃取用户信息或控制用户会话,使用安全的域名可以减少XSS攻击的风险。

保护用户数据

在JS中,经常需要与服务器进行数据交互,如果使用不安全的域名,可能会导致敏感数据泄露,给用户带来安全隐患。

提升用户体验

安全的域名可以增强用户对网站的信任度,提升用户体验。

安全域名选择策略

使用HTTPS协议

HTTPS协议可以在传输过程中对数据进行加密,防止数据被窃取,确保你的JS资源通过HTTPS协议加载。

特性HTTPS协议HTTP协议
加密
安全性
速度可能稍慢

限制跨域请求

通过设置CORS(跨源资源共享)策略,可以控制哪些域名可以访问你的JS资源,从而减少潜在的安全风险。

在js分享中,如何确保使用安全域名避免潜在风险?

使用子域名

将JS资源部署在子域名上,可以隔离不同功能模块,降低安全风险。

实用安全策略

安全策略(CSP)

CSP可以帮助你控制哪些资源可以在你的网页上加载和执行,从而防止XSS攻击。

验证输入数据

在JS中处理用户输入时,务必进行严格的验证,防止恶意代码注入。

使用安全的第三方库

在开发过程中,尽量使用经过验证的第三方库,减少安全风险。

FAQs

Q1:如何检测JS资源是否通过HTTPS协议加载?

在js分享中,如何确保使用安全域名避免潜在风险?

A1: 可以使用浏览器的开发者工具,查看网络请求的协议类型,如果协议类型为HTTPS,则表示资源通过HTTPS协议加载。

Q2:CORS策略如何设置?

A2: CORS策略可以通过HTTP响应头中的Access-Control-Allow-Origin字段进行设置,以下代码允许所有域名的跨域请求:

Access-Control-Allow-Origin: *

在实际应用中,应该根据具体需求设置允许的域名。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/179781.html

(0)
上一篇2025年12月20日 12:24
下一篇 2025年12月20日 12:28

相关推荐

  • 不同类型域名注册费用大揭秘,网上注册域名究竟需要多少钱?

    网上注册域名多少钱?域名注册价格概述域名是互联网上标识网站的唯一标识符,对于企业和个人来说,拥有一个合适的域名至关重要,网上注册域名的价格是多少呢?以下将为您详细介绍,域名注册价格影响因素域名后缀域名后缀(如.com、.cn、.net等)是影响域名注册价格的重要因素之一,国际顶级域名(如.com、.net等)的……

    2025年12月2日
    0120
  • 移动域名与PC域名有何区别?如何选择更适合企业的域名?

    在数字化时代,域名的选择对于个人和企业来说至关重要,随着互联网的普及,移动设备和PC端设备的使用日益频繁,移动域名和PC域名成为了两个重要的选择,本文将详细介绍移动域名和PC域名的特点、优劣势以及如何选择合适的域名,移动域名与PC域名的定义移动域名移动域名是指专门为移动设备设计的域名,它能够更好地适应移动端浏览……

    2025年10月31日
    0200
  • 如何高效通过邮箱操作查找到特定域名的所有相关信息?

    如何在邮箱中查域名?随着互联网的普及,域名已经成为企业、个人和组织身份的重要标志,了解如何通过邮箱查域名,可以帮助我们更好地管理自己的网络资源,确保域名安全,以下是如何通过邮箱查域名的详细步骤和方法,使用域名查询工具1 选择合适的查询工具我们需要选择一个可靠的域名查询工具,市面上有很多免费的域名查询服务,如阿里……

    2025年12月11日
    0110
  • 顶层域名和顶级域名有何区别?为何如此重要?

    在互联网的世界中,域名是连接用户与网站的关键,而在这个庞大的域名体系中,有两个概念至关重要:顶层域名(Top-Level Domain,简称TLD)和顶级域名,本文将深入探讨这两个概念,帮助读者更好地理解它们在互联网中的作用,什么是顶层域名(TLD)?定义顶层域名是域名系统中最高级别的域名,位于域名结构的最顶端……

    2025年11月2日
    0180

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注